阅读量:2
Android ADB(Android Debug Bridge)是一个强大的命令行工具,它允许与Android设备进行通信。虽然ADB本身并不是一个性能测试工具,但你可以使用它来执行一些与性能相关的操作和命令。以下是一些建议的步骤来进行Android设备的性能测试:
- 确保你的开发环境已经配置好:
- 安装Android Studio。
- 启用开发者选项和USB调试。
- 使用USB数据线将Android设备连接到电脑。
- 安装必要的ADB工具:
- 确保你的电脑上已经安装了ADB工具。如果没有,可以从Android SDK中获取。
- 检查设备连接:
- 在命令行中输入
adb devices,确保你的设备已经成功连接并被识别。
- 使用ADB执行性能监控命令:
- CPU信息:
adb shell cat /proc/cpuinfo可以查看设备的CPU信息。 - 内存信息:
adb shell cat /proc/meminfo可以查看设备的内存使用情况。 - 网络流量:
adb shell cat /proc/net/tcp和adb shell cat /proc/net/udp可以查看网络流量信息。 - 磁盘I/O:
adb shell cat /proc/diskstats可以查看磁盘I/O使用情况。 - 应用列表和包信息:
adb shell pm list packages和adb shell dumpsys package可以查看设备上安装的应用列表和特定应用的详细信息。
- 使用第三方性能测试工具:
- 虽然ADB本身不是性能测试工具,但你可以结合使用第三方性能测试工具,如Apache JMeter、LoadRunner或Android Studio自带的Profiler工具。
- 这些工具可以模拟大量用户同时访问应用,从而帮助你评估应用的性能。
- 记录和分析性能数据:
- 使用上述命令和工具收集性能数据。
- 分析这些数据,找出性能瓶颈和潜在问题。
- 优化和调整:
- 根据分析结果,对应用进行优化和调整。
- 重复上述步骤,直到达到满意的性能水平。
请注意,进行性能测试时要确保你的设备处于正常运行状态,并避免在测试过程中对设备造成不必要的负担。此外,对于复杂的性能测试,建议在一个受控的环境中进行,以便更准确地评估应用的性能。
以上就是关于“android adb怎样进行性能测试”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m